While Raymond, Minnesota, isn't typically known for its trout fishing, a few smaller streams and stocked lakes in the surrounding area offer opportunities to catch rainbow trout. These are often managed as put-and-take fisheries, meaning the trout are stocked for anglers to catch. Check the Minnesota DNR website for the most up-to-date stocking information and regulations. Spring and fall are generally the best times to target rainbow trout, as the water temperatures are cooler. Early morning or late evening can also be productive. A practical tip is to use light tackle and small lures or flies. Rainbow trout can be easily spooked in these smaller waters. Consider fishing with small spinners, spoons, or dry flies. The rainbow trout in these stocked waters are typically hatchery-raised and range in size from 10 to 14 inches. While not trophy-sized, they provide a fun and accessible fishing experience.

Rainbow Trout Fishing Regulations in Minnesota
Open Season
Year-round in some streams; varies by lake
Daily Bag Limit
5 per day (combined with other trout species)
Size Limit
No size limit in most lakes; varies by stream
License Required
Resident or Non-resident Fishing License; Trout Stamp may be required
Some streams have special regulations, including catch-and-release only sections. Check specific regulations for the waterbody.
